Exportar a Excel con SpreadSheetlight

Servicios de Desarrollo Web, Software y Aplicaciones moviles, & Soporte tecnico, blog oficial de tecnologia y mas

Exportar a Excel con SpreadSheetlight

Todo lo referente a practicas en Visual Studio

En artículos anteriores se ha explicado el concepto del lenguaje de programación Vb.net y Asp.net Webform. Sin embargo falta saber sobre la librería SpreadSheetlight, que hizo posible exportar a Excel.

Dicha librería hizo posible la exportación de información a Excel desde un sistema web hecho con Asp.net Webform con Microsoft Visual Studio 2012.

SpreadSheetLight es una librería de código abierto diseñada para facilitar la creación y manipulación de archivos Excel en aplicaciones .NET. 

Desarrollada por Vincent Tan, esta librería es conocida por su simplicidad y eficiencia, lo que la convierte en una herramienta popular entre los desarrolladores que utilizan Visual Studio 2012.

Características Principales

  1. Fácil de Usar: SpreadSheetLight está diseñada para ser intuitiva y fácil de usar, incluso para desarrolladores que no tienen experiencia previa con la manipulación de archivos Excel. 
    • Su API es sencilla y bien documentada, lo que permite una rápida integración en proyectos existentes.
  2. Compatibilidad con Excel: La librería soporta la creación y manipulación de archivos en formato XLSX, el estándar moderno de Excel. 
    • Esto incluye la capacidad de trabajar con hojas de cálculo, celdas, rangos, estilos, gráficos y más.
  3. Rendimiento Eficiente: SpreadSheetLight está optimizada para manejar grandes volúmenes de datos sin sacrificar el rendimiento. 
    • Esto es especialmente útil en aplicaciones empresariales donde la manipulación de grandes hojas de cálculo es común.
  4. Sin Dependencias Pesadas: A diferencia de otras librerías de manipulación de Excel, SpreadSheetLight no requiere la instalación de Microsoft Office en el servidor o máquina cliente, lo que simplifica su despliegue y reduce los requisitos de sistema.

Ventajas de Usar SpreadSheetLight

  • Simplicidad: Su diseño intuitivo permite a los desarrolladores centrarse en la lógica de negocio sin preocuparse por los detalles complejos de la manipulación de archivos Excel.
  • Documentación Completa: La librería cuenta con una documentación extensa y ejemplos claros, lo que facilita su aprendizaje y uso.
  • Comunidad Activa: Al ser una librería de código abierto, cuenta con una comunidad activa que contribuye con mejoras y soporte, asegurando que la librería se mantenga actualizada y relevante.

Desventajas

  • Funcionalidades Avanzadas Limitadas: Aunque SpreadSheetLight cubre la mayoría de las necesidades básicas, puede carecer de algunas funcionalidades avanzadas que ofrecen otras librerías comerciales.
  • Soporte Limitado para Formatos Antiguos: La librería se centra en el formato XLSX y puede no ser la mejor opción si necesitas trabajar con formatos más antiguos como XLS.

SpreadSheetLight es una excelente opción para desarrolladores que buscan una solución sencilla y eficiente para la manipulación de archivos Excel en aplicaciones .NET, especialmente cuando se utiliza Visual Studio 2012.

Su facilidad de uso, rendimiento eficiente y la ausencia de dependencias pesadas la convierten en una herramienta valiosa para una amplia variedad de proyectos.

Aunque puede no ofrecer todas las funcionalidades avanzadas de otras librerías comerciales, su simplicidad y efectividad la hacen destacar.

Exportar a Excel con Vb.net y Asp.net Webform

Hola, Si desean exportar a Excel les recomiendo este ensamblador y que es compatible con versiones de office 2007/2010/2013.

Ingresa a su pagina oficial: http://spreadsheetlight.com

Para su instalación ingresar al siguiente enlace:

https://www.nuget.org/packages/SpreadsheetLight

O escribes: «spreadsheetlight» entrando al menu Proyecto/administrar PaquetesNugets y lo instalas

Para Exportar a Excel debes descargar el siguiente ensamblador:

https://www.nuget.org/packages/DocumentFormat.OpenXml

o escribes: «DocumentFormat.OpenXml» entrando al menu Proyecto/administrar PaquetesNugets y lo instalas.

Recomendado para los que usan ASP.NET en Visual Studio 2012,2013 y 2015

Otra Referencia en caso de que no quieran usarlo:

https://closedxml.codeplex.com

 

Deja un comentario